Amends the Illinois Insurance Code. Creates the Insurance Rate Fairness and Consumer Protection Article. Provides that the Article may be cited as the Insurance Rate Fairness and Consumer Protection Law. Provides that rates shall not be excessive, inadequate, or unfairly discriminatory, as specified. Provides that companies issuing policies within the applicability of the Article shall not incorporate catastrophe or extreme event losses from other states into the development of Illinois rates if fully credible loss experience is available within the State of Illinois. Effective immediately.
